Sina Technology has learned that Xiaopeng Group recently held a production mobilization meeting for robots, with nearly 1,000 employees from various centers such as automotive, power, manufacturing, testing, and general intelligence attending. He Xiaopeng, Vice President Gu Jie, and LC Mi, the head of the robot center, attended the meeting, marking the official entry of Xiaopeng's robot business into the mass production sprint phase. During the meeting, He Xiaopeng outlined key milestones: achieving mass production of humanoid robots by the end of 2026 and entering Xiaopeng's offline stores as salespersons in the first quarter of 2027. He also emphasized that Xiaopeng's robots are independently developed from chips to operating systems, from joints to dexterous hands, making it the only full-stack robot company in China. Previous high investments will bring higher quality, aesthetics, and more comprehensive capabilities. He Xiaopeng said, "At this stage, we are equivalent to Xiaopeng Motors 8 years ago." At that time, Xiaopeng had just completed the release and mass delivery of their first car, the G3. Now, the robot team is replicating this path. In terms of production capacity construction, Xiaopeng's humanoid robot production base started construction in Guangzhou in the Guangtang Science and Technology Innovation City in February this year, covering an area of approximately 110,000 square meters to support full-scale production along the entire chain.
